How Do Timers And Counters Work In Embedded C Applications? Are you interested in understanding how timers and counters function within embedded systems? In this detailed video, we'll explore the core concepts behind these essential hardware modules used in microcontrollers. We’ll explain how timers operate like precise stopwatches, counting internal clock pulses to measure time intervals accurately. You’ll learn about how timers can trigger actions at specific moments through interrupts, enabling efficient time management in your projects. Additionally, we’ll cover counters, which are designed to tally external events, such as sensor signals or switch presses, providing valuable data for various applications.

The video will guide you through controlling these modules using embedded C, including setting hardware registers, configuring clock sources, adjusting prescaler values, and managing interrupts. We’ll also showcase practical examples, such as creating delays, scheduling periodic tasks, generating PWM signals for motor control, and counting external pulses for real-world applications. Whether you're working with microcontrollers like the 8051 or other embedded platforms, understanding how to configure and utilize timers and counters is vital for building reliable and precise systems.
